What Biochemical Adaptations Help Deep Sea Life Survive Cold And Pressure? Have you ever wondered how deep sea creatures survive in one of Earth's most extreme environments? In this fascinating video, we'll explore the biochemical adaptations that allow marine life to thrive under intense pressure and freezing temperatures. We'll start by explaining how cell membranes are modified with special fats called lipids to stay flexible and functional in cold, high-pressure waters. You'll learn about the role of proteins and enzymes, which are adapted to resist unfolding and maintain their activity despite the harsh conditions. We’ll also discuss how some animals produce unique antifreeze proteins that prevent ice crystal formation, protecting their cells from damage. Additionally, we’ll cover how their bodies are built with gelatinous tissues that withstand crushing pressure and how their metabolic rates slow down to conserve energy in food-scarce environments. Genetic changes also play a vital role, with certain species developing genes that support survival at depths exceeding 6,000 meters.
